Most small patches, the kind a doorknob or a chair leg makes, land in the low hundreds of dollars. Cost climbs when the damaged area is large, when the wall has a heavy texture to match, or when water damage means the panel has to come out. Your quote will break this out before any work starts.
A crack that returns after patching usually means something is still moving. Common causes are a settling foundation, a truss lifting with the seasons, or a seam that was taped poorly when the house was built. A good handyman will tell you whether it is a surface fix or a sign of something bigger.
Yes. Orange peel, knockdown, and smooth finishes can all be matched. Texture matching is the part that separates a repair you notice from one you do not, so tell us the finish when you request a quote and we will send it to handymen who do that work regularly.
For patching, crack repair, and single panel replacement, a handyman is the right call. You need a licensed specialist when the drywall is coming down because of a leak, mold, or a wall being moved. If your job crosses that line, we will tell you and match you with the right trade instead.
Most handymen in our network will prime and paint the repaired area. Matching paint that has aged on the wall for years is not always exact, so some homeowners choose to have the full wall repainted. Ask for both prices when you get your quote.
